java - How to Move JLabes Around -


import java.awt.flowlayout; import javax.swing.jframe; import javax.swing.jlabel;           public class gui_window extends jframe {             private jlabel main_l;              public gui_window() {                 setlayout(new flowlayout());                  main_l = new jlabel("did know possible bind keys?");                 add(main_l);             }                  public static void main (string args[]) {                     gui_window gui = new gui_window();                     gui.setdefaultcloseoperation(jframe.exit_on_close);                     gui.setsize(300,300);                     gui.setvisible(true);                     gui.settitle("gamers audiomute");                     gui.setresizable(true);               }         } 

i know how move "did know" label around. state how align left, right, middle , how move around coordinates?

img of program

you can use methods included in swing classes. try

mainl.sethorizontalalignment(swingconstants.left); mainl.setverticalalignment(swingconstants.bottom); 

the 2 methods sethorizontalaligment , setveritcalalignment both take integers set start of either horizontal or vertical component of label pixel integer within swing window.

you should read on swingconstants allow plug in pre-defined integers swing align texts desirable locations within panel. here's link

http://docs.oracle.com/javase/7/docs/api/javax/swing/swingconstants.html

they useful when manipulating different layouts such borderlayout , gridlayout.


Comments

Popular posts from this blog

asp.net mvc - SSO between MVCForum and Umbraco7 -

Python Tkinter keyboard using bind -

ubuntu - Selenium Node Not Connecting to Hub, Not Opening Port -